Brown <br />County Administrator <br />DATE: December 30th, 2019 <br />SUBJECT: 2020 Indian River County Legislative Priorities <br />BACKGROUND <br />The 2020 Florida Legislative Session begins on January 14th, 2020. Indian River County staff has <br />put together a proposed legislative program which includes an appropriation for the North <br />Sebastian Septic to Sewer program and policies related to biosolids, higher -speed passenger rail, <br />recycling, and other relevant policy areas which affect Indian River County. <br />In addition to specific policy issues, the proposed legislative program contains a number of guiding <br />principles as well as a policy statement directing opposition to any legislative action which takes <br />away the home rule authority of local governments in Florida. <br />RECOMMENDATION <br />County staff recommends that the Board adopt the proposed 2020 Indian River County Legislative <br />Priorities. <br />ATTACHMENTS <br />2020 Indian River County Legislative Priorities <br />125 <br />
